     John Nelson Graham John Nelson Graham, 77 of Check, passed away on Sunday, May 23, 2021. He is preceded in death by his parents, Nelson & Ollie Graham; sons, David Nelson Graham and John Anthony Graham; brother, Douglas Allen Graham; and daughter-in-law, Jennifer Covey. John was a lifetime member of the Locust Grove Fire Department and had served as Lieutenant. Following 20 years of work as a qualified machinist, John spent another 20 years of service as a highway and local truck driver alongside his wife, Barbara, before retiring. He led an extraordinary life which included being a Scout Master and an Elder in The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ints. "Bill" Rylee died on November 10, 1992 at Pinellas Co., Florida, at age 77.2,3,4 He William "Bill'' Rylee, 77, one of four brothers who played for the Kids & Kubs softball team and the Liniment Leaguers, died Tuesday (Nov. 10, 1992) of cancer at the Laurels. His son, Bill, said he was captain of a Kids & Kubs team and was former captain of the Liniment Leaguers and the Bartlett League. Mr. Rylee was the youngest of the four brothers who were good hitters and outfielders, according to an article published in the Evening Independent. In all, there were six boys in the family; two stayed in Pennsylvania. The eldest of the four ballplayers, Harry, died in August 1991 at the age of 81. At the time of his brother's death, Mr. Rylee said that he and his brothers played on the same semiprofessional baseball team in the 1930s. "My father was the manager and one of our victories was with the House of David, a touring group that wore beards,'' he said. "We gave up baseball by the 1940s for the fast pitch of softball and, after we retired, we got together and returned to playing softball. My brother was a real nice guy, and we had some great times together,'' he said. A native of Lancaster, Pa., Mr. Rylee was a seasonal resident from West Grove, Pa., until he retired in 1980 and permanently moved here. He was a machine operator for West Grove Knitting Mills.
